Drywall Water Damage Repair in Conroe, TX
Drywall water damage repair services address issues caused by leaks, flooding, or high humidity that compromise the integrity of interior walls. This service involves assessing the extent of moisture intrusion, removing damaged drywall, and thoroughly drying the affected areas to prevent mold growth. Projects typically include replacing sections of drywall in basements, bathrooms, or living spaces where water has penetrated, as well as restoring the wall surfaces to their original condition. Property owners often seek this service when noticing signs such as discoloration, warping, or a musty odor, and want to ensure that their walls are properly restored and protected from future damage.
Before requesting drywall water damage repair,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ved and whether the underlying cause of moisture has been addressed. It’s important to consider if additional repairs, such as fixing plumbing leaks or improving ventilation, are necessary to prevent recurrence. Clear communication about the extent of damage, the materials used for repairs, and the process for restoring wall surfaces can help property owners make informed decisions about their repair needs and ensure a long-lasting solution.

Drywall Water Damage Repair Questions
What causes drywall water damage? Water damage to drywall often results from leaks, spills, or high humidity that allows moisture to penetrate the material.
How can water damage affect drywall? Water exposure can cause warping, mold growth, and deterioration of drywall surfaces if not addressed promptly.
What are common signs of drywall water damage? Signs include discoloration, bubbling or peeling paint, and soft or sagging drywall panels.
Why is prompt repair important? Addressing water damage quickly helps prevent mold growth, structural issues, and further damage to the property.
